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Finally Riot.js @4 has been released
Search
kkeeth
June 01, 2019
Programming
2
140
Finally Riot.js @4 has been released
kkeeth
June 01, 2019
Tweet
Share
More Decks by kkeeth
See All by kkeeth
Programming to play with p5.js
clown0082
0
72
とある EM の初めての育休からの学び
clown0082
1
5.2k
The history of Javascript frameworks: changes in front-end design philosophy
clown0082
2
220
Visually experience the beauty of mathematics with p5.js
clown0082
1
3.2k
Rediscover the joy of coding with Creative Coding
clown0082
0
1.8k
全員が意思決定する会社で開発者体験や生産性を見る大変さについて
clown0082
0
650
JavaScript × Mathematics go to Digital Art
clown0082
1
440
In-house study group at YUMEMI
clown0082
0
230
Playing Ionic Logo by p5.js
clown0082
0
330
Other Decks in Programming
See All in Programming
new(1.26) ← これすき / kamakura.go #8
utgwkk
0
2.4k
CSC307 Lecture 14
javiergs
PRO
0
470
コーディングルールの鮮度を保ちたい / keep-fresh-go-internal-conventions
handlename
0
200
クライアントワークでSREをするということ。あるいは事業会社におけるSREと同じこと・違うこと
nnaka2992
1
340
コードレビューをしない選択 #でぃーぷらすトウキョウ
kajitack
3
990
PostgreSQL を使った快適な go test 環境を求めて
otakakot
0
560
Swift ConcurrencyでよりSwiftyに
yuukiw00w
0
270
How to stabilize UI tests using XCTest
akkeylab
0
130
AI 開発合宿を通して得た学び
niftycorp
PRO
0
130
モジュラモノリスにおける境界をGoのinternalパッケージで守る
magavel
0
3.6k
ふつうのRubyist、ちいさなデバイス、大きな一年 / Ordinary Rubyists, Tiny Devices, Big Year
chobishiba
1
460
OTP を自動で入力する裏技
megabitsenmzq
0
110
Featured
See All Featured
Collaborative Software Design: How to facilitate domain modelling decisions
baasie
0
160
Lessons Learnt from Crawling 1000+ Websites
charlesmeaden
PRO
1
1.1k
Designing for Timeless Needs
cassininazir
0
170
Building Experiences: Design Systems, User Experience, and Full Site Editing
marktimemedia
0
440
The World Runs on Bad Software
bkeepers
PRO
72
12k
Kristin Tynski - Automating Marketing Tasks With AI
techseoconnect
PRO
0
200
Product Roadmaps are Hard
iamctodd
PRO
55
12k
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
37
6.3k
Getting science done with accelerated Python computing platforms
jacobtomlinson
2
140
Building the Perfect Custom Keyboard
takai
2
710
The Language of Interfaces
destraynor
162
26k
The B2B funnel & how to create a winning content strategy
katarinadahlin
PRO
1
300
Transcript
Finally Riot.js @4 has been released ॳՆͷJavaScriptࡇ in ϝϯόʔζΩϟϦΞ k-kuwahara
@kuwahara_jsri @clown0082
About me
Basic Information const my_info = { Workplace: ‘Yumemi Inc’, Community:
‘Riot.js, Ionic, DIST’, Skills: ‘Riot.js, Ionic, Nuxt, Node.js’, PokemonGO: ‘TL39’ }
Sorry... " Plz feedback for me called “Masakari” about my
English.
before that …
Have you ever used riot before?
What is ?
URL: https://riot.js.org/
URL: https://riot.js.org/ In plain words, Riot.js is a react-like ui
library
Characteristics ‣ Custom tags(Component based) ‣ Simple syntax ‣ Human-readable
‣ Small leaning curve
Made with Riot URL: https://riot.js.org/made-with-riot/
Next @4
None
riot has some breaking changes. Let’s pick up some of
them.
Change Riot4
Change Riot4 type, src, extension are changes
Change Riot4
Change Riot4 export default syntax !!
Change Riot4 props, state arguments !!
Pick up some of the changes @4 ‣ “this.tags” ‣
“riot-observable” ‣ “shouldUpdate” method ‣ “:scope” → “:host” ‣ parser/compiler ‣ high performance
For more details, URL: https://speakerdeck.com/clown0082/re-revolution-to-front-end-with-riot-dot-js
⚠Caution⚠
I think that there is a potential bug, because it
has just been released
Pick up other changes. (not source code)
The new Logo up to v3 v4
The new home page(v4)
The new home page(up to v3) URL: https://v3.riotjs.now.sh/
Japanese Translation URL: https://github.com/riot/riot.github.io/issues/235
Japanese Translation URL: https://github.com/riot/riot.github.io/issues/235 Plz send PRs to us !!
Please wait for the official release Riot.js@4!!
Publicity
We’re looking for Engineers!!
None